Through the agency of others too, and we are thus informed that it is to the slave's advantage to leave his master for freedom: if so, they should be combined and taught together: By money and by deed through the agency of others or his own? - But [it means this:] By money, both through the agency of others and his own; by deed, through the agency of others but not his own, and it agrees with R'Simeon B'Eleazar. For it was taught: R'Simeon B'Eleazar said: By deed too only through the agency of others, but not his own.<span class="x" onmousemove="('comment',' He does not hold that the deed and his rights of acquisition come simultaneously.');"><sup>14</sup></span> Thus there are three differing opinions in the matter.<span class="x" onmousemove="('comment',' (i) R.
